




静电喷涂生产线喷枪移动调节
为了更加灵活的适应喷涂生产线,提升生产功率,在实际喷涂生产中需要对主动喷枪移动速度和移动行程进行调节;一起需要对主动喷枪横向的方位进行调节,保证喷枪口到不同形状工件的距离在抱负的范围内。
远程监控要求
需要采集喷涂参数上传到上位机,经过上位机软件监控喷涂现场的喷涂作业状况,一起又能经过上位机软件对喷涂现场的控制器进行参数装备,实现将喷涂现场与操作人员的隔离,保证工人身体健康。
静电喷涂生产线体系防爆性要求
喷粉室中静电喷枪喷出的许多粉料粉尘都是具有可燃性,假如粉尘在空气中达到一定的比例,一旦遭受电气设备发生的电弧火花或者机械设备发生的机械火花、摩擦火花,或者是某一个喷涂设备的发热,都有或许导致粉尘原因,造成严峻的人员安全和经济上的丢失壳维护防机制。当电压足够高的时候静电喷枪端部的电极针周围构成空气电离区,使电极针邻近的空气发生强烈电晕放电。因此,对相关喷涂设备进行防爆设计、安装与维护,依照安全标准设计设备外,急停措施,保证喷涂生产作业的安全进行。在设计电路和软件时要提前设计预,备好相应应对措施。
静电喷涂生产线
静电喷涂生产线操控器的采样周期设为20ms,每周期采样64次核算均值保存,作为一次ADC采样的采样值,定时器的触发周期为(20000us/64)=s。静电喷涂生产线显示:在自检状态下,各数字管的参数显示子程序依次调用键显示模块显示参数1s,用于检查硬件是否处于良好状态。为了保证其他模块可以运用完整的ADC采样数据,防止数据在运用前被覆盖,目标存储区选用64*2的存储缓冲区。使用DMA的DMA_ IT_ HT和DMA IT TC中断分别对前后两部分采样数据进行操作。
DAC输出模块程序设计
静电喷涂生产线操控器的静电电压输出是MCU通过DAc数模转化输出电压再由线性放大电路进行放大输出。反馈信号结合静电喷涂控制器的工作模式和工作状态输出控制电压,调节输出静电喷涂生产线静电电压或静电电流。操控器选用的数模转化参阅电压是3V,而12位的DAC转化数据范围为0409-5,不便于直观表明DAC输出电压值。所以界说函数DAC_Set Vol(uintl6_ t vol),参数vol取值范围为03000,表明输出电压范围为0-3V。在这个函数中先将03000的数值按份额转化为04096的DAC数模转化参数,再调用库函数输出电压。
操控算法模块程序设计
静电喷涂生产线操控器实现了输出静电电压、静电电流、流速气压和雾化气压的自动操控,静电电压、静电电流由MCU的DAc输出操控,通过静电电压、静电电流操控算法计算得到DAC的输出量。操控器设计的参数调理规模包括市面上干流操控器的气压操控范围,尽可能满意操控器与其他产品配件的兼容性。流速气压、雾化气压由步进电机调理,通过流速气压、雾化气压操控算法核算得到步进电机的滚动步数和滚动方向。所以,静电喷涂生产线操控算法模块包括四个部分,静电电压操控、静电电流操控、流速气压操控、雾化气压操控,都是选用数字PI操控算法.
所显示的静电喷涂生产线数据是由密钥或接收到的测量数据所设置的数据。数据接收程序设计采用串行IDLE空闲中断接收数据,静电喷涂生产线采用双缓冲区接收数据,尽量防止数据丢失。它是十六进制数据。它需要转换为常用的十进制数据,并分解成单独的位、10位和100位。显示状态包括:只显示,用0表示;闪烁显示,用1表示;不显示,用2表示。以3位数字管显示器的参数为例,为了满足操作面板的显示要求,需要六种显示状态。用012编码,它们是222非显示、000非闪烁、001位闪烁、010位闪烁、100位闪烁和111位全闪烁。如果还有其他要求,可以使用更多的编码。
静电喷涂生产线除了能够单独的控制每个位的显示之外,用于显示寄存器操作的其他显示程序设计的另一个优点是它可以显示特殊字符。2)静电喷涂生产线能够静确地操控静电参数和气压参数,确保喷涂时上粉率足够高,喷涂质量足够好。8位1字节数据分别代表8段数码管对应的8位LED,写一段LED熄灭,写0段LED发光。因此,我们可以设计错误显示子程序。当控制器通过自检检测出内部错误或硬件错误时,调用函数显示特殊字符“Err”以指示故障,并显示故障代码sErrorCode以方便设备的维护和维修。此外,在操作面板中有六个指示灯,静电喷涂生产线由BC7277控制。它们是由BC7277控制的显示位的LED控制段的两个段。因此,可以通过使用显示寄存器控制来点亮指示灯,以将对应的数据段写入0。